Ingredients
- 4 cups fresh corn kernels or thawed frozen corn
- 2 tablespoons butter
- 1/4 cup mayonnaise
- 1/4 cup sour cream
- 1 teaspoon garlic powder
- 1 teaspoon chili powder
- 1/2 teaspoon paprika
- 1 tablespoon lime juice
- 1/4 cup crumbled cotija cheese
- 2 tablespoons fresh cilantro, chopped
- 1/2 teaspoon salt
- 1/4 teaspoon black pepper
How to Make Street Corn?
To begin, warm the butter in a skillet over medium heat and saute the corn until it becomes lightly golden and aromatic. This step enhances the natural sweetness of the corn and provides a flavourful foundation. Stirring gently ensures the corn develops a uniform texture without losing its natural crunch. The aroma released during this stage signals the perfect moment to add the creamy elements.
Once the corn is lightly toasted, add the mayonnaise and sour cream while the skillet is still warm. Mix thoroughly until every kernel is coated with a smooth and silky sauce. Incorporate garlic powder, chili powder, paprika, salt, and black pepper to create depth and a bold flavour profile. Finish by removing the pan from heat, then stirring in lime juice, followed by a garnish of crumbled cotija cheese and fresh cilantro to complete the authentic street corn experience.

Storage and Reheating
Leftover creamy street corn should be stored in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to two days. To reheat, gently warm the mixture on the stove with a splash of cream or water to restore its original softness. Freezing is not recommended as the cream-based sauce may separate, altering the dish’s texture.
Suggestions and Variations
For an extra kick, roasted jalapenos can be added to elevate the heat. Using Greek yogurt instead of sour cream provides a lighter, tangier alternative. This versatile recipe also works beautifully as a topping for baked potatoes, tacos, or even grilled meats. A sprinkle of lime zest can be added just before serving for a refreshing citrus lift.

FAQs
Can I make this recipe with canned corn
Yes you can use canned corn but draining it well and sauteing it briefly improves the flavour.
Can I prepare the dish ahead of time
You can prepare it earlier but add lime and toppings just before serving for best taste.
What cheese can replace cotija
Feta cheese provides a similar salty and crumbly character.
